New Town Apartments

New Town Apartments is situated in the North East of the New Town, just a walk or short bus ride from Princes Street and Waverley Station. You will be within easy reach of the Royal Botanic Gardens and the Playhouse Theatre when you book your own private apartment at New Town Apartments. With the flexibility to come and go as you please, you can set your own itinerary. To orientate yourself you could head to nearby Calton Hill, which offers panoramic views of the city from its City Observatory.

Edinburgh New Town Apartments provides you with a compact, centrally heated, open plan studio. You will have a sleeping area, a bathroom (bed linen, toiletries and towels provided), a lounge area with colour TV/DVD player, and a kitchen with fridge, dishwasher and washing machine. Get your groceries from the supermarket around the corner and use the microwave, oven and toaster to cook your own meals. Edinburgh New Town Apartments also provide a hairdryer, alarm clock, iron/board and WiFi access.

The University of Edinburgh and Heriot-Watt University are easily accessible from New Town Apartments, as are Napier University and Queen Margaret University College. Lots of language schools are also within easy reach, including Edinburgh School of English and Regent Edinburgh.

The nearest station to New Town Apartments is Waverley, Edinburgh's main station. You can visit St Andrews (home of golf) in a sixty minute journey, or be in Glasgow in less than an hour. Other Scottish destinations easily accessible from Waverley include Dunfermline (30 minutes) and Dundee (1 hour 15 minutes).

When you stay New Town Apartments you won't have to go far to enjoy a drink or a meal out – the bars and restaurants of Broughton Street are just a short stroll away. You can enjoy fantastic panoramic views from nearby Calton Hill, or take an even shorter walk and marvel at the flowers in the Royal Botanic Gardens. Walk, or take a bus, to Princes Street and Edinburgh Castle, or head to Leith's Ocean Terminal - the shopping arcade designed by Terence Conran.

To check-in (from 15:00) you must go to the check-in office at 6 Queen Street, where you will be given your keys and directions to your apartment. Free luggage storage is available for early arrivals at 6 Queen Street. Late check-outs must be arranged in advance (or at check-in) and incur a charge, as does luggage storage on your departure day. You will find a concierge service, phone, fax, safe and DVD library at the check-in office at 6 Queen Street.

Please note:

There is no lift at New Town Apartments. If you have restricted mobility you should highlight this when booking so that a suitable apartment can be allocated.

Your apartment will be serviced every 7 days, and cots and highchairs are available upon request.

Please note: due to a smoking ban on all public areas in Scotland, all areas of this accommodation are non-smoking.
